Product Description

The Epro PR6424/107-100 16mm Eddy Current Sensor is a precision displacement and vibration measurement device designed for non-contact monitoring of industrial machinery and turbines. Utilizing eddy current technology, this sensor provides accurate, reliable, and fast response measurements, even in demanding industrial environments.

The sensor is suitable for real-time monitoring of shaft displacement, vibration, and alignment, allowing operators to detect early signs of mechanical issues such as imbalance, misalignment, or bearing wear. Its compact and robust design ensures simple integration into machinery, while maintaining high measurement stability and durability.

Product Specifications

Parameter Specification
Model Number PR6424/107-100
Device Type Eddy Current Sensor
Sensing Principle Eddy Current
Measurement Range ±1 mm (depending on calibration)
Output Signal Voltage or current output depending on interface
Sensitivity High sensitivity for precise displacement measurement
Linearity ≤ ±1% full scale
Frequency Response DC to 10 kHz
Operating Temperature -20°C to +120°C
Storage Temperature -40°C to +125°C
Relative Humidity 0–95%, non-condensing
Protection Class IP65
Material Stainless steel housing
Mounting Threaded or clamp mounting
Sensor Head Diameter 16 mm
Weight 0.2 kg
Shock Resistance 50 g, 11 ms
Vibration Resistance 20 g, 10–2000 Hz

FAQ

  1. What sensing principle does the PR6424/107-100 use?

    It operates on the eddy current principle, enabling non-contact measurement of shaft displacement and vibration.

  2. What is the typical measurement range of this sensor?

    The standard range is ±1 mm, which can be calibrated according to application requirements.

  3. What is the frequency response of this sensor?

    The sensor supports DC to 10 kHz, allowing detection of both slow displacement changes and high-frequency vibrations.

  4. Is the sensor suitable for high-temperature applications?

    Yes, it operates reliably between -20°C and +120°C, making it suitable for industrial machinery and turbine environments.

  5. What type of output signals does the sensor provide?

    It provides voltage or current outputs, compatible with standard industrial monitoring equipment.

  6. How precise is the PR6424/107-100 sensor?

    It has a linearity of ≤ ±1% full scale, ensuring accurate measurements for high-precision applications.

  7. Can it withstand vibration and shock?

    Yes, it is rated for 20 g vibration (10–2000 Hz) and 50 g shock (11 ms), making it robust for harsh industrial conditions.

  8. What mounting options are available?

    The sensor can be installed using threaded or clamp mounting, depending on the machine setup.

  9. Is the sensor protected against dust and moisture?

    Yes, it features IP65 protection, allowing reliable operation in dusty or wet industrial environments.

  10. Can this sensor be used for predictive maintenance?

    Yes, it provides continuous displacement and vibration monitoring, supporting condition-based and predictive maintenance strategies.
